Who will sing for the New Year public celebration in Sarajevo?

Published: December 16, 2015
Share
SHARE

Hiljade Sarajlija Novu godinu dočekalo uz vatromet i muzikuFor the fifteenth consecutive time, the City of Sarajevo is organizing public New Year 2016 celebration at the Square of the Children of Sarajevo (Trg djece Sarajeva), in front of the BBI Center.

Exclusively performers of the B&H music scene will perform during New Year’s Eve, including Amel Ćurić, Zoster, Vela havle and Radarska kontrola, and the celebration will be complemented with spectacular fireworks.

As in previous years, partners of the city in organizing the celebration are the Sarajevo Canton and four city municipalities: Stari Grad, Centar, Novo Sarajevo and Novi Grad. They will also get support by the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the Sarajevo Canton, the Tourist Board of the Sarajevo Canton, and media sponsors.

As a leader of this project, the City of Sarajevo will put maximum efforts to provide great fun and entertainment for all those who decide to welcome the New Year 2016 in the B&H capital.

The City of Sarajevo, together with its partners, invites the citizens of Sarajevo, citizens of other cities and municipalities in B&H, as well as guests from the region to come to the Square of the Children of Sarajevo and together welcome the New Year 2016.

Through rich entertaining contents, the fifth Coca-Cola Sarajevo Holiday Market will also provide a true holiday ambience. Honorary sponsor of the Holiday Market is the City of Sarajevo.

Instead of a Christmas tree that the City of Zagreb intended to buy as a gift for the City of Sarajevo, Zagreb donated 4,000 EUR to children suffering from malignant diseases and children without parental care, in order to cheer up the forthcoming holidays for at least a bit.
